It was meant to be the most enchanting day of their lives.

Last week, a couple’s marriage proposal at Disneyland Paris was cut short when a park employee impeded their romantic moment.

Now that a video of the incident has gone viral, Disney has apologized for the employee’s actions.

“We regret how this was handled,” a spokesperson from Disney told Newsweek. “We have apologized to the couple involved and offered to make it right.”

The video, which was initially posted on Reddit, displayed a man proposing to his girlfriend on one knee. The employee is then observed snatching the ring box and shooing the guests away from the platform in front of the Sleeping Beauty Castle.

Prior to the incident, the user who posted the video stated that the man had obtained approval to propose on the platform.

Audience members can be heard booing the employee in the video.
